PRINCE OF WALES

TO VISIT ARGENTINE

[United Press Association—By Electric Telegraph.—Copyright.)

(Received this day at 9.40 a.in.) D'JNDON, November 7

In order to open the British Trade Exhibition at Buenos Aires in March, the Prince of Wales is sailing for Argentine Aboard the- Oroposa on 15th. January, travelling as an ordinary passenger, on n( series of the world’s msot luxurious vessels. Tie will probably lie accompanied by Prince George and a suite of ten persons.

The Prince calls -at Bermuda. Havana-, Panama and Yarparaiso. He departs from Buenos Aires aboard the Alcantara, the crack ship on the South American run for Rio Do Janeiro, and tours Brazil for throe weeks, returning to England aboard the Arlan'/.a due on Apiil 28th.

Tlie Prince may fly while in South America, utilising one of the aeroplanes aboard the aircraft carrier Eagle which will lie stationed at Buenos Aires during the exhibition.
